Output dab20befc542025ad5de1d311d96a620e20a44f35c5c047cc29950b5d566373a:15

value
703860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679c8b5338c11db0dcf29531a4325a6486a43347 OP_EQUAL
address
3B8s4BnDJ1xHsxaWoMKp1yayF5wyV6kBaY
transaction
dab20befc542025ad5de1d311d96a620e20a44f35c5c047cc29950b5d566373a
spent
true